    I missed you, she says against the arched crest of the kelpie’s neck, soft words whose meaning is solidified in the way Isobell pulls him tightly to her chest. “Of course you did,” He replies against the curve of her ear, quiet enough that only she will hear, each syllable clearly spoken through a smile. When he pulls away it is to look at her with an adoring smile, an expression that has not been shaped by his scaled lips in nearly half a decade. Her absence had been overlong, he realizes in a brief moment of emotional clarity

    More than all the others, Isobell has always been Ivar’s favorite. She would fight him long after reason, full of fury and fire that he has only ever been able to find semblances of since her disappearance. The women of Beqanna are soft and fragile, sustenance that never truly feeds the hunger, pale candles against the blazing wildfire of his dragon-born wife. They are easy prey though, so gentle and willing, so eager to follow a handsome stranger in a dance beneath the waves.

    But none have satisfied him. Not in the way that Isobell can, the way only a woman of his own kind might. Here around them are proof of this: three fine kelpies that she’d borne him, with no struggle to conceive like the rest of his harem, no weak and land-bound daughters. The reminder of this brings a sudden heat to the way he holds her, a firmer hold as his mouth slides down the line of her neck to brush against the scars he had left her.

    A sharp inhale is the only sign of his visceral reaction to the way his serrated teeth brush gently against the long-healed wounds, and then he is drawing back with that same smile that he has only ever found for her.

    “You’re staying?” he asks, but Isobell will know it is a command. The children too, he suspects, they will understand the safety that comes from being near family, near the sea. There is one he is doubtful of, the girl who quivers at Lothbrok’s side. Ivar had looked at her dismissively before, considering her less important than Isobell and his children. This opinion doesn’t change as he licentiously traces the lines of her piebald shape, knowing the direction of his gaze is hidden by the way he holds Isobell to him. Not family, not his (yet), she is of less interest than the parrots that caw in the jungle.

    He does glance toward the greenery for a moment as he pulls away from Isobell, a reasonable area for him to have been observing as he held her, and then takes another step back to meet the kelpie woman’s gaze squarely.

    “You’ve returned at a pivotal moment in Beqanna,” he tells them all, though his golden eyes remain mostly on Isobell. “I intend to make Ischia the ruling kingdom of the west. I can’t help but think Fate might have brought you back to help.” Fate is an omnipotent presence in the life of the kelpie, a being with a fondness for the jewel-toned stallion, a benevolent hand when he was in need of a turn of good luck. Surely it is responsible for the return of a queen to his shore just when he was in most desperate need of one, responsible for the tangible reminder of his virility in the shape of three water-born offspring.

    He’d prefer the children were gone in this particular moment, he thinks as his eyes catch on the downward curve of Isobell’s throat, but with the world opening around him he is certain he will have plenty of opportunities to show Isobell exactly how much he has missed her as well.
